=== 3. Next on the homosexual movement's list: Repeal of
Massachusetts "1913 Law" banning marriages to out-of-state
couples if that
marriage would be illegal in their home state. Watch out, America!
===
Almost immediately after last week's Constitutional Convention
vote, Gov.
Deval Patrick and the legislative leadership announced that they're
not stopping
with just homosexual "marriage" in Massachusetts. They
want to spread it across
America.
They plan to repeal the so-called "1913 Law" that bans
out-of-state couples from
marrying in Massachusetts if that marriage would be illegal in their
home state.
